Category Archives: Savannah

Nicky’s Pizza Savannah, GA

Far, far away in one of the oldest cities in America, lies a little pizzeria called Nicky’s. It is off the beat and path, about 10 mins or so from downtown Savannah in the city’s Garden City district. You might be asking yourself by now… what is the Mad Greek doing in the middle of nowhere chowing down on a slice of Nicky’s, reheated pepperoni pizza?

Is he lost, and looking for helping being located? Is he trying to find the county of Hazzard? Or is he is feeding his addiction to finding the perfect 8 for 8 slice in America. I’d go with the latter of the three. Unfortunately, Nicky’s did score an 8, but don’t lose hope, it was pretty damn good considering.